dc.description.abstract | The ultrastructure of the spermatozoon of Allopodocotyle pedicellata (Digenea, Opecoelidae), an intestinal parasite of the teleost Sparus aurata (gilt-head bream), is described by means of transmission electron microscopy (TEM). The mature spermatozoon possesses two axonemes ofthe 9+"1" trepaxonematan pattern, an anterior electron-dense material, two mitochondria, a nucleus, external ornamentation of the plasma membrane, spine-like bodies and parallel cortical microtubules distributed into two bundles. The anterior electron-dense material and the morphology of the anterior mitochondrion are the noteworthy characters that distinguish the spermatozoon of A. pedicellata from those of most opecoelids. However, a comparative study with the remaining opecoelids described so far, reveals similarities in their ultrastructural organization. Thus, the sperm model is established for the Opecoelidae and it is compared to mature spermatozoa of other digeneans, particularly those belonging to the family Opistholebetidae and the superfamilies Allocreadioidea and Brachycladioidea or their related sister groups. The morphology of the posterior spermatozoon extremity, the disposition of cortical microtubules and the association of external ornamentation with cortical microtubules and spine-like bodies appear as interesting elements with phylogenetic significance for the Opecoelidae. | - |
